As someone has already said, it would be cheaper for you to take out a loan in your own name, because that is effectively what you are proposing, but at a much higher interest rate.
This is solely to "improve" a credit file.
A £2000 loan on Amigos Website suggests repayments of £97.58 per month over 36 Months. Total repayable £3,512.58.
If all goes swimmingly well, these two are going to pay £1,512.88 JUST TO GET A GREEN TICK ON A CREDIT FILE!!!
Now let's factor in the enevitable missed payments, defaults, fees and breakup of a good friendship the whole post deserves a multiple facepalm that people can be so daft.0 -
